php的数组类型有哪些


这篇文章主要介绍了php的数组类型有哪些的相关知识,内容详细易懂,操作简单快捷,具有一定借鉴价值,相信大家阅读完这篇php的数组类型有哪些文章都会有所收获,下面我们一起来看看吧。 在PHP中,数组是最常用的数据结构之一。数组是一个包含一个或多个元素的数据结构,每个元素都有一个独特的键(索引)。在PHP中,有三种不同的数组类型:数字索引数组、关联数组和多维数组。第一种类型是数字索引数组,这种数组的索引是数字,从0开始递增。可以使用数组()函数或者简写的[]符号来创建数字索引数组。例如:

//使用数组()函数创建数字索引数组
$numbers=array(1,2,3,4,5);

//使用简写的[]符号创建数字索引数组
$numbers=[1,2,3,4,5];

当需要访问数组元素时,可以使用数组的索引,例如$numbers[2]将返回3。第二种类型是关联数组,这种数组的索引是字符串,也称为键值对数组。可以使用数组()函数或者简写的[]符号来创建关联数组。例如:

//使用数组()函数创建关联数组
$colors=array(
"red"=>"#FF0000",
"green"=>"#00FF00",
"blue"=>"#0000FF"
);

//使用简写的[]符号创建关联数组
$colors=[
"red"=>"#FF0000",
"green"=>"#00FF00",
"blu免费云主机域名e"=>"#0000FF"
];

当需要访问数组元素时,可以使用相应的键。第三种类型是多维数组,这种数组包含其他数组,也可以称为数组的数组。多维数组可以是任意维度的。例如,以下是一个二维数组:

$users=[
[
"name"=>"John",
"age"=>30,
"email"=>"john@example.com"
],
[
"name"=>"Jane",
"age"=>25,
"email"=>"jane@example.com"
],
[
"name"=>"Bob",
"age"=>40,
"email"=>"bob@example.com"
]
];

要访问多维数组中的元素,需要使用两个索引。例如,$users0将返回John。除了上述的数组类型,PHP还提供了一些有用的数组函数,例如array_push()、array_pop()、array_shift()、array_unshift()和array_slice()等。这些函数可以帮助开发人员在操作数组时更高效地处理数据。在PHP中,数组是一个强大且常用的数据结构。借助于数组及其相关函数,开发人员可以轻松地操作和处理各种数据。关于“php的数组类型有哪些”这篇文章的内容就介绍到这里,感谢各位的阅读!相信大家对“php的数组类型有哪些”知识都有一定的了解,大家如果还想学习更多知识,欢迎关注百云主机行业资讯频道。

相关推荐: np.array()函数如何使用

这篇文章主要讲解了“np.array()函数如何使用”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“np.array(免费云主机域名)函数如何使用”吧!各个参数意义:object:创建的数组的对象,可以为单个值,…

免责声明:本站发布的图片视频文字,以转载和分享为主,文章观点不代表本站立场,本站不承担相关法律责任;如果涉及侵权请联系邮箱:360163164@qq.com举报,并提供相关证据,经查实将立刻删除涉嫌侵权内容。

Like (0)
Donate 微信扫一扫 微信扫一扫
Previous 06/21 10:57
Next 06/21 10:58

相关推荐